The Atmel® AT24C128C provides 131,072-bits of Serial Electrically Erasable and Programmable Read-Only Memory (EEPROM) organized as 16,384 words of 8 bits each. The device’s cascading feature allows up to eight devices to share a common 2-wire bus. The device is optimized for use in many industrial and commercial applications where low-power and low-voltage operation are essential.
The devices are available in space-saving 8-lead JEDEC SOIC, 8-lead TSSOP, 8-pad UDFN, 8-pad XDFN, 8-ball VFBGA, and 4-ball WLCSP packages. In addition, this device operates from 1.7V to 5.5V.
Standard Features
Low-voltage and Standard-voltage Operation
̶ VCC = 1.7V to 5.5V
Internally Organized as 16,384 x 8
2-wire Serial Interface
Schmitt Trigger, Filtered Inputs for Noise Suppression
Bidirectional Data Transfer Protocol
400kHz (1.7V) and 1MHz (2.5V, 2.7V, 5.0V) Compatibility
Write Protect Pin for Hardware Protection
64-byte Page Write Mode
̶ Partial Page Writes Allowed
Self-timed Write Cycle (5ms Max)
High Reliability
̶ Endurance: 1,000,000 Write Cycles
̶ Data Retention: 40 Years
Lead-free/Halogen-free Devices Available
Green Package Options (Pb/Halide-free/RoHS Compliant)
̶ 8-lead JEDEC SOIC, 8-lead TSSOP, 8-pad UDFN, 8-pad XDFN,
8-ball VFBGA, and 4-ball WLCSP Packages
Die Sale Options: Wafer Form, Waffle Pack, and Bumped Wafers
Pin Function
A0: Address Input
A1: Address Input
A2: Address Input
GND: Ground
SDA: Serial Data
SCL: Serial Clock Input
WP: Write Protect
VCC: Device Power Supply
AT24C128C, 128K Serial EEPROM: The 128K is internally organized as 256 pages of 64-bytes each. Random word addressing requires a 14-bit data word address.
